Members of the L.A.P.D. in downtown Los Angeles. National Guard troops in riot gear surrounded a federal building. Protests started near a complex of federal buildings but spread to other areas downtown in the evening. Law enforcement officers were stationed around the federal complex all day.
A federal judge's order to halt Trump's Guard deployment to LA was paused by an appeals court, even as DHS Secretary Noem vowed continued immigration raids that have sparked national protests.
California has challenged the administration's move to call up the National Guard over the objections of Governor Gavin Newsom.
A temporary restraining order said the deployment of the Guard was illegal and exceeded Trump’s statutory authority.
